 For my project I made an Alice In Wonderland mini album. I haven't put the finishing touches on yet because I'm not sure exactly what I am putting in it. I cut the album from a Cricut file I made on my Gypsy and all the paper is DCWV from the Dazzle Stack. All cuts are from my Cricut Disney Classics cartridge.
 This fabulous digi image is Mad Hatter by Heather Valentin available from Scrapbook Stamp Society  I colored her with Prismacolor Premiere Pencils blended with odorless mineral spirits.

Cupcake Hottie

This digi image is Cupcake Hottie by Heather Valentin. Available for purchase through Scrapbook Stamp Society. Made for my Addicted To Stamps design team. Colored with Copics and her wings are clear star gelly pen. I love how it gives a glittery transparent look to the wings. Sentiment is Stampin Up. DCWV paper from the Sweet Stack. Twine from Trendy Twine.

My project is a Peace On Earth Holiday Wreath. It features a digi-image by Heather Valentin. I cut the rosettes on my Cricut using the Ribbons and Rosettes cartridge. Then I stamped with  Versamark and clear embossing powder. I added some buttons and Twinery Twine.

 This is a close up of the digi image you can win as blog candy! I colored her with Copics and added a lot of Stickles for extra sparkle!
I cut this banner using Cottage Cutz dies and my Cricut for the letters. Covered in Stickles and hung on Stampin' Up red Hemp Twine and Twinery green twine.
